    quick Apparition question,

    For those of you that have an Apparition (single motor): How does it turn at low speed??? Can it be used as a "recovery" boat? I tried a Spartan but that was a big no-go (didnt turn at all at low speed). I also have the Apparition in the box, thought maybe I would throw an ESC in it and give it a shot, But if somebody already has this info then I don't need to waste my time with it..


    thanks for the help.

    Depends on what hardware you put on it. A stock inline rudder maybe, but for a good rescue boat something with a steerable outdrive works best at low speed. I use a apache 24 with a 35T brushed motor. Works awesome! I also used a Rio Ep, the dual rudder setup worked well but the apache works better imho.
